If you plan on keeping the oem mid pipes then even a straight pipe won't be that "LOUD". Once you start with removal of primary cats or have hfc, catless, that's when it starts to get LOUD!
I would probably go with a catless mid section and a moderate axle back muffler if this is a DD.

With that said, Meisterschaft super gt, rpi gtm, innotech f1, gintani race, and topspeed pro-1 are all really loud axle backs.
